How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Sumner Glenw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
North Sumner Glenwood Studio Apartments | $1,343 | $612 | $5,735 |
North Sumner Glenw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,761 | $745 | $10,000+ |
North Sumner Glenw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,684 | $704 | $10,000+ |
North Sumner Glenw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,600 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
North Sumner Glenw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,224 | $1,983 | $5,341 |

Frequently Asked Questions about North Sumner Glenwood
How much are Studio apartments in North Sumner Glenwood?
There are currently 265 Studio Apartments in North Sumner Glenwood with rent ranges from $612 to $5,735 with an average price of $1,343.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om North Sumner Glenw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in North Sumner Glenwood ranges from $745 to $13,079 with an average monthly rent of $1,761.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in North Sumner Glenw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in North Sumner Glenwood range from $704 to $12,360.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,684.
How expensive are North Sumner Glenw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 115 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in North Sumner Glenw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,300 to $11,923 - averaging $3,600 for the location.
